Commercial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can clean up the spill yourself, but be sure to dry the area thoroughly to prevent further damage. |
| Large water spill (over 1 gallon) | No | Yes | A large water spill need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ract and dry the affected area properly. |
|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under flooring) |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and extract the water properly. |
|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g., electrical room or data center) | No | Yes | Water damage in sensitive are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e working environment. |
| Water damage with visible m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and prevent further growth. |
| Water damage with structural damage (e.g., warped or buckled flooring) | No | Yes | Structural dam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air and prevent further damage. |

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Mont Belvieu, TX
The cost of commercial water extraction in Mont Belvieu, TX, can vary depending on the severity and size of the damage, as well as local conditions.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of drying process.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ed, and level of sanitizing required.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s. |
| Hidden Water Damage Detection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and level of detection required. |
| Mold Remediation |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of mold growth, and level of remediation required. |
